Exploring Automation Campaign Triggers:

Automation triggers are the catalysts that initiate predefined actions within workflows. Understanding these triggers is essential for maximizing the efficiency of automation campaigns. Let's take a closer look at each trigger provided by Gameball:

  • Account Created

    Triggered once a customer creates an account, the Account Created trigger marks the beginning of a user's journey with your business. This trigger presents an opportunity for you to initiate onboarding processes, welcome new users, and provide valuable information or incentives to encourage further engagement.

  • Ondate Trigger

    Start automation on a specific date/time with the Ondate Trigger. This feature allows businesses to schedule automation campaigns in advance, ensuring the timely execution of tasks and communications. For example, Black Friday, flash sale, brand anniversary, etc.

  • Receive Event

    This trigger is activated when a customer completes a specific action on the platform. Whether it's making a purchase, writing a review, filling out a survey, viewing a product, or engaging with content, the Receive Event trigger allows you to respond promptly to user interactions. Here is how to add an event (available only on Guru and Pro as an add-on for Shopify users)

    All you have to do to set up the Receive Event trigger is:

    1. Click on Add Event on the Card

    2. From the side pop-up, Choose Event

    3. Apply the Filters you need

    4. Press Save

    Note: When selecting "Receive Event," you'll need to describe the exact event criteria using the Event Engine.

  • Level Changed

    Activated when a customer levels up or down, the Level Changed trigger enables businesses to tailor experiences based on a customer's progression within a game or application. This trigger is invaluable for delivering personalized messages or rewards to users as they advance through different levels.

    All you have to do to set up the Level Changed trigger is:

    1. Click on Add Level on the Card

    2. From the side pop-up, Choose Level

    3. Press Save

  • Challenge Achieved:

    Initiated upon the completion of a designated challenge, the Challenge Achieved trigger empowers businesses to recognize and reward customers accomplishments effectively. Whether it's conquering a difficult task or achieving a milestone, this trigger allows for timely acknowledgment and incentivization.

    All you have to do to set up the Challenge Achieved trigger is:

    1. Click on Choose Badge on the Card

    2. From the side pop-up, Choose the badge

    3. Press Save

  • Segment Entered:

    Triggered when a customer joins a specific segment, the Segment Entered trigger enables businesses to target users based on their characteristics or behaviors. This trigger facilitates targeted communication and engagement strategies.

    All you have to do to set up the Segment Entered trigger is:

    1. Click on Choose Segment on the Card

    2. From the side pop-up, Select the Segment

    3. Press Save

  • Segment Exited:

    Triggered when a customer leaves a specific segment, the Segment Exited trigger enables businesses to re-engage dormant customers, this trigger also facilitates targeted communication and engagement strategies.

    All you have to do to set up the Segment Exited trigger is:

    1. Click on Choose Segment on the Card

    2. From the side pop-up, Select the Segment

    3. Press Save

  • Tag Added

    Activated when a specific tag is applied to a customer, the Tag Added trigger allows businesses to categorize and track users based on predefined criteria. This trigger is invaluable for implementing targeted marketing campaigns or segmenting users for personalized experiences.

    All you have to do to set up the Tag Added trigger is:

    1. Click on Choose Tag on the Card

    2. From the side pop-up, Select the Tag

    3. Press Save

  • Tag Removed

    Activated when a specific tag is removed from a customer, the Tag Removed trigger allows businesses to categorize and track users based on predefined criteria. This trigger is also invaluable for implementing targeted marketing campaigns or segmenting users for personalized experiences.

    All you have to do to set up the Tag Removed trigger is:

    1. Click on Choose Tag on the Card

    2. From the side pop-up, Select the Tag

    3. Press Save

  • Webhook Trigger:

    Initiated by an external app via webhook, the Webhook Trigger enables seamless integration with third-party platforms and services.
